Most affordable antihistamines fall into two categories: first-generation ones like diphenhydramine (Benadryl) and second-generation ones like loratadine (Claritin) or cetirizine (Zyrtec). The first-gen types work fast but make you sleepy—useful if you’re tossing and turning at night, but not ideal for daytime. The second-gen ones? They last longer, cause less drowsiness, and are the go-to for daily use. You’ll find these in most pharmacies, online stores, and even discount retailers. In fact, a 30-day supply of generic loratadine can cost under $5 at some online pharmacies, compared to $30+ for the brand.

Not all allergies respond the same way. If one antihistamine doesn’t help after a week, try another. Some people react better to cetirizine, others to fexofenadine. It’s trial and error, but it’s worth it. And if you’re using antihistamines daily for months, talk to a doctor. Long-term use might mask something else—like sinus infections or environmental triggers you can actually fix.

There’s also a growing trend of combining antihistamines with other simple fixes: saline nasal rinses, air purifiers, or washing bedding in hot water. These don’t replace medication, but they reduce how much you need.
